1. USDA News: LIVINGSTON COUNTY Livingston County farmers qualify for disaster ...
Some Livingston County farmers may qualify for federal disaster assistance as they recover from an April freeze that damaged crops throughout the state. The designation qualifies farmers in those counties who sustained production losses between April 3 and April 11 for USDA assistance, including low-interest emergency loans. Farmers in 26 contiguous counties also are eligible for such assistance. According to the USDA, the freeze damage caused approximately 160,000 acres of wheat not to be...

4. USDA News: Federal subsidies to junk food
The foods that nutritionists recommend we eat more of vegetables and fruits are considered specialty crops and arent eligible for direct government support. Many of those crops end up going into feed for livestock, sweeteners or cheap oil for fast food. If you dont think government has any control over what we eat, check out the facts that Newsweek discovered: For every dollar the USDA spends on nutrition education, the food industry spends $24 on ads and marketing. 6. USDA News: USDA lifts quarantine on hogs fed contaminated food
WASHINGTON - Federal food safety regulators announced Tuesday that the level of contaminated animal feed consumed by hogs does not pose a risk to humans who eventually consume that pork, and they have lifted a quarantine that kept 56,000 hogs from going to slaughter.
